Agriculture sector: Rice exporters discuss juvenile rights

Leading rice exporters arrange training workshop to raise awareness among women and rice millers


APP September 11, 2020

ISLAMABAD:

Leading rice exporters of Pakistan arranged a training workshop on Thursday to raise awareness among women and rice millers regarding basic juvenile rights of the children of female agriculture workers, especially the rice transplanters.

Rice Partners Country Manager for Sustainability and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) Zafar Iqbal said that his firm provided best facilities for promoting decent working conditions among rice transplanting women and children throughout the rice value chain from agro-fields to rice mills. He added that his organisation had trained 30,000 female rice transplanters and also raised awareness regarding juvenile rights.

Addressing the event, Senior Corporate and Development sector Consultant Annan Waffi Qureshi said that juvenile rights should be prioritised in every sector of the economy including agriculture.
